What Makes Jamaican Food So Irresistible?

Before we dive into the specific restaurants and culinary hotspots, let’s take a moment to appreciate what makes Jamaican food so uniquely delicious. It’s more than just a collection of ingredients; it’s a symphony of flavors carefully crafted through centuries of tradition and cultural exchange. At its heart, Jamaican food is bold, spicy, and undeniably satisfying.

One of the defining characteristics of Jamaican cuisine is its complex flavor profiles. The iconic jerk seasoning, a blend of allspice, Scotch bonnet peppers, thyme, garlic, ginger, and other spices, is a prime example. This fiery concoction, traditionally used to marinate chicken, pork, or fish, infuses the meat with a smoky, spicy, and incredibly aromatic flavor that is both addictive and unforgettable.

Beyond the spice, Jamaican cuisine also embraces savory and sweet elements. Coconut milk, derived from the island’s abundant coconut trees, adds a creamy richness to many dishes. Plantains, whether fried to a golden crisp or baked to a sweet, caramelized perfection, provide a delightful counterpoint to the savory flavors. Rice and peas (which, despite the name, are usually kidney beans cooked with coconut milk and herbs) are a staple side dish, offering a comforting and flavorful accompaniment to almost any Jamaican meal.

Key ingredients like Scotch bonnet peppers, known for their intense heat, demand respect and are often used sparingly to add a fiery kick. Other common ingredients include callaloo (a leafy green vegetable), okra, various meats (chicken, goat, beef, and fish), and an assortment of fresh fruits and vegetables.

Jamaican food is more than just a culinary experience; it’s a reflection of the island’s history and culture. It’s a blend of African, European, and Asian influences, resulting in a unique and vibrant cuisine that tells a story with every bite. The use of spices, the slow-cooking techniques, and the emphasis on fresh, local ingredients all contribute to the authenticity and depth of Jamaican flavors.
